Publisher Description

Neuroplasticity is the new theory of how the brain can change/heal itself. With this knowledge, a creative technology was developed and used to improve cognition by artificially improving the thought processes of the human brain. 

However, the technology developed, called the ithinkPad, was taken by a nefarious global organization, covertly supported by the CIA and the Pentagon, to be used for criminal activity. But the twist in the tail is the way in which John Tilbury, ex SAS, ASIO spook and his assassin mate Thomas Black track down these evil people who used the ithinkPad for illicit intelligence gathering and impacting the lives of innocent people. All around them are the lives and relationships of people affected that complicate Tilbury’s pursuit through the tenticles of OASIS..
